An island has some portion submerged in water. Point A on the island is at negative 7 over 3 feet from the surface of the sea. P

oint B on the island is at negative 5 over 2 feet from the surface of the sea. Because negative 7 over 3 feet > negative 5 over 2 feet, what is true about the distance of the two points from the surface of the sea?
Point A is closer to the surface of the sea than point B.
Point B is closer to the surface of the sea than point A.
Both points are 4 and 5 over 6 feet from the surface of the sea.
Both points are 1 over 6 feet from the surface of the sea.

Answer: is B point B is closer to the surface then point A

Step-by-step explanation:

-7 over three is further from the surface because its further from 0 since - 5 over 2 is closer to 0 that means its closer to the surface.
